Get Version of REST Proxy API
get
/restproxy/api/version
Get the version of the REST proxy API.
Request
There are no request parameters for this operation.

Examples
This endpoint is used to get the version of the restproxy API.
The following example shows how to know the version of your restproxy API by submitting a GET request on the REST resource using cURL.
curl -v -u <username>:<password> -X GET \ https://<rest proxy of your blockchain instance>/api/version
For example,
curl -v -u obpuser:<password> -X GET \ https://myvm.oracle.com:10001/restproxy/api/version
Note:
You can find the rest proxy value of your blockchain instance from the Nodes tab of your instance console.Example of the Response Body
The following example shows the contents of the response body in JSON format:
{ "returnCode": "Success", "error": "", "result": "v2.0.0" }
